Beam brackets are used in construction and are designed to connect wooden beams or joists. They are primarily used in roofs, decks, floors, and ceilings to create a strong, long-lasting support and provide excellent stability.

When a beam bracket is installed correctly, it will hold the wooden beams in place as the wood naturally twists and moves over time. They ensure that the wooden beams maintain a true fit, ensuring long-term durability and rigidity.

Most beam brackets open on the top or bottom edge of a wooden beam on around three sides and are secured with nails. There is a connecting plate beam bracket that is secured to the surrounding frame. They are versatile and are significantly stronger than using traditional nails or screws alone.
